Do you know if all the DD3 MIJ versions have the old 'n' big Roland chip? I know that all the DD2's have it, but what about the Japan made DD3's? How can someone recognise an old Japanese DD3 on Ebay?

Yes I would expect that one to be a Japanese pedal. The pedal itself is indistinguishable from the newer version from that angle but the Pocket Dictionary is Vol 2 from 85 and the box is whiter than the new box that is slightly yellow.

Thank you for the replies :) So the 1985 Japanese DD3's had the large Roland chip?

Yes it did. The change to the new square chip was probably done around 1989 somewhere.
